How much do logistics coordinator j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 14, 2026, the average hourly pay for logistics coordinator in Rutherford, NJ is $22.99,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$19.13 and $25.48 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Can I be a logistics coordinator with no experience?

Logistics coordinator roles often require some knowledge of supply chain management, inventory, and transportation, but many entry-level positions are available for candidates with little or no experience. Relevant skills such as organization, communication, and familiarity with logistics software can help you qualify, and some employers offer on-the-job training or certifications to develop necessary skills.

What Is a Logistics Coordinator?

A logistics coordinator regulates the supply chain for product-based companies, such as importers. As a logistics coordinator, your responsibilities and duties include overseeing the delivery of products, ensuring documentation is accurate, managing customs requirements, and communicating with clients and customers regarding deliveries and timelines. You must be able to comply with all safety requirements and laws to protect clients’ investments. You are also responsible for troubleshooting any problems that arise and handling customer complaints. You work with the distribution manager to keep them up to date on product shipments and transport needs.

What is the difference between Logistics Coordinator vs Supply Chain Specialist?

AspectLogistics CoordinatorSupply Chain Specialist
C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; certifications like CLTD or CSCP beneficialSimilar credentials; often requires additional supply chain certifications
Work EnvironmentOffice-based with some site visits; coordinating shipments and transportationOffice and warehouse; managing end-to-end supply chain processes
Employer & Industry UsageLogistics and transportation companies, manufacturing, retailManufacturing, retail, logistics, and distribution sectors
Search & Comparison IntentFocuses on transportation and shipment coordinationBroader supply chain management including procurement and inventory

The main difference is that a Logistics Coordinator primarily manages transportation and shipment logistics, while a Supply Chain Specialist oversees the entire supply chain process, including procurement and inventory management. Both roles require similar credentials and are used across various industries, but their scope and focus differ.

What qualifications do you need to be a logistics coordinator?

A logistics coordinator typically needs a high school diploma or equivalent, with many employers preferring a bachelor's degree in supply chain management, business, or a related field. Strong organizational, communication, and problem-solving skills are essential, along with proficiency in logistics software and tools like ERP systems. Relevant certifications, such as the Certified Supply Chain Professional (CSCP), can enhance job prospects.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Logistics Coordinator,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Logistics Coordinator, you need strong organizational abilities, attention to detail, and a background in supply chain management or logistics, often supported by a relevant degree or equivalent experience. Familiarity with logistics software (such as SAP, Oracle, or TMS), tracking systems, and sometimes certifications like APICS or CLTD is typically expected. Excellent communication, problem-solving, and multitasking skills help you excel in coordinating shipments and resolving issues efficiently. These qualities ensure smooth operations, timely deliveries, and cost-effective logistics solutions in a fast-paced environment.

What does a logistics coordinator do?

A logistics coordinator manages the movement, storage, and distribution of goods within a supply chain. They coordinate with suppliers, transportation providers, and warehouses, often using logistics software, to ensure timely delivery and efficient operations.

Logistics Coordinator

Elizabeth, NJ

Compensation Includes

  • Starting Pay Rate of $21.63 - 26.44/hour   

Overview

Responsible for setting up delivery appointments and customer pickups. Notifying customer service representative and warehouse team if there are any discrepancies with shipments. To perform this job successfully, an individual must be able to perform each essential duty satisfactorily. The requirements listed below are representative of the knowledge, skill, and/or ability required.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.

Responsibilities

  • Set up delivery and customer pick up appointments
  • Confirm inventory on product before shipping
  • Respond to email in a timely manner
  • Assist Warehouse Supervisors with the assignments for the Forklift drivers and other duties
  • Assist Warehouse Supervisors on any tasks needed
  • Request carriers for pre-loaded shipments and entering loads into TMS
  • Other miscellaneous duties as assigned by management
  • Make decisions about how to correct situations and errors. Should keep Warehouse Supervisor informed of progress

Qualifications

  • Reading, writing, and basic math skills are needed for this job
  • Must be computer literate and have knowledge of Microsoft AX, Excel, Word and Outlook
  • Must be able to problem-solve to make sure that customers are satisfied
  • Must be able to effectively communicate with other employees and management
  • Knowledge of forklifts
  • Self-managing organization and time management skills
  • High School diploma or GED

Physical Requirements

  • Lifting; a minimum of 50 lbs.
  • Carrying; a minimum of 50 lbs.
  • Pulling; 2 hours
  • Pushing; 3 hours
  • Reaching above shoulders
  • Walking; 8 hours
  • Standing; 8 hours
  • Kneeling; 4 hours
  • Bending; 6 hours
  • Climbing;6 hours
  • Operation of forklift, scissor lift, or other vehicle
  • Visual ability
  • Ability to distinguish colors.
  • Hearing ability
